AIML - Data Infrastructure Software Engineer, Machine Learning Platform and Technologies
63 Days Old
AIML - Data Infrastructure Software Engineer, Machine Learning Platform and Technologies Pay: Competitive
Employment type: Other
Job Description Req#: 200480836
Summary The Data Infrastructure group within the AI/ML organization powers analytics, experimentation, and ML feature engineering that enable the Machine Learning technologies in our Apple devices. Our mission is to provide cutting-edge, reliable, and user-friendly infrastructure for ingesting, storing, processing, and interacting with data, while ensuring privacy and security for Appleās users.
Key Qualifications 5 years of experience in software engineering with strong fundamentals in computer science.
Proficiency in data structures and algorithms, with the ability to produce high-quality code, test cases, and review pull requests in a fast-paced environment.
Expertise in one or more programming languages such as Scala or Java.
Fluency in scripting or systems programming languages like Python, Bash, or Go.
Experience with distributed data systems like Hadoop, Spark, Kafka, or Flink.
Knowledge of public cloud platforms, preferably AWS, is a plus.
Excellent collaboration and communication skills, both verbal and written.
Description This role involves managing petabytes of data for machine learning applications, designing and implementing frameworks for scalable data processing workflows, and building efficient ML pipelines. Responsibilities include ensuring data lineage and legal workflow integration, optimizing system performance and scalability, monitoring system health, and resolving issues. The candidate will work on cutting-edge technology and collaborate with cross-functional teams to deliver high-quality software solutions.
The ideal candidate will have a strong software development background, experience with cloud platforms, and familiarity with distributed databases.
Education & Experience BS, MS, or PhD in Computer Science or equivalent.
Additional Requirements Pay & Benefits: The base pay range is $170,700 to $300,200, depending on skills, experience, and location. Employees may participate in stock programs, receive benefits such as medical, dental, retirement, discounts, and educational reimbursement. Bonuses, commissions, and relocation may also be available. Learn more about Apple Benefits.
About the Company Join Apple! Discover how you can make an impact through our various work areas, global locations, and opportunities for students.
#J-18808-Ljbffr
- Location:
- Santa Clara, CA, United States
- Category:
- IT & Technology